Компьютеры

Как запустить Geckodriver в Linux?

Как работает Geckodriver?

Действия по добавлению пути в системную переменную среды PATH

  1. В системе Windows щелкните правой кнопкой мыши Мой компьютер или Этот компьютер.
  2. Выберите Свойства.
  3. Выберите дополнительные параметры системы.
  4. Нажмите кнопку «Переменные среды».
  5. В разделе «Системные переменные» выберите PATH.
  6. Нажмите кнопку «Изменить».
  7. Нажмите кнопку Создать.
  8. Вставьте путь к GeckoDriver.

18 февраля. 2021 г.

Какая версия Geckodriver у меня установлена ​​в Linux?

Просмотрите версию Selenium WebDriver, которую вы используете, как показано ниже: Затем перейдите на https://firefoxsourcedocs.mozilla.org/testing/geckodriver/geckodriver/Support.html и проверьте требуемую версию Firefox, совместимую с Selenium. и драйвер Gecko: в моем случае версия Selenium Webdriver — 3.9.

Куда поставить Geckodriver?

Существует простой способ установить Geckodriver:

  • Установите webdrivermanager с помощью pip. pip установить webdrivermanager.
  • Установите драйвер для Firefox и Chrome. webdrivermanager firefox chrome linkpath /usr/local/bin.
  • Или установите драйвер только для Firefox. …
  • Или установите драйвер только для Chrome.
пссст: Как импортировать файл CSV в Linux?

17 декабря 2016 г.

Как загрузить и установить Geckodriver?

Загрузите и установите драйвер Gecko:

  1. Шаг 1) На этой странице https://github.com/mozilla/geckodriver/releases выберите версию для загрузки GeckoDriver, соответствующую вашей операционной системе.
  2. Шаг 2) После завершения загрузки ZIPфайла извлеките содержимое ZIPфайла в папку с файлами.

13 февраля. 2021 г.

Какой драйвер используется для автоматизации Firefox?

Marionette — это контроллер автоматизации для движка Mozilla Gecko. Вы можете удаленно управлять пользовательским интерфейсом или внутренним JavaScript платформы Gecko, такой как Firefox.

Что такое геккодрайвер?

GeckoDriver — это движок веббраузера, используемый во многих приложениях, разработанных Mozilla Foundation и Mozilla Corporation. GeckoDriver — это связующее звено между вашими тестами Selenium и браузером Firefox. GeckoDriver — это прокси для использования клиентов, совместимых с W3C WebDriver, для взаимодействия с браузерами на основе Gecko.

Какие языки поддерживает селен?

Selenium WebDriver (Selenium 2.0) полностью реализован и поддерживает Python, Ruby, Java и C#.

Как обновляется Geckodriver?

посетите https://github.com/mozilla/geckodriver/releases. загрузите последнюю версию «geckodrivervX. ХХ.

3 ответа

  1. Распакуйте архив командой: tar xvzf geckodriver *
  2. Сделайте его исполняемым: chmod + x geckodriver.
  3. Добавьте драйвер в PATH, чтобы другие инструменты могли его найти: export PATH = $PATH:/pathtoextractedfile/.

11 янв. 2017 г.

Как проверить версию селена?

Вы также можете запустить locate selenium в терминале, и вы увидите номер версии в именах файлов.

Как использовать Geckodriver в селеновом питоне?

Загрузите последнюю версию geckodriver отсюда. Добавьте файл geckodriver.exe в каталог Python (или любой другой каталог, уже указанный в PATH).

Я использую Windows 10, и это сработало для меня:

  1. Загрузите geckodriver отсюда. …
  2. Разархивируйте только что загруженный файл и вырежьте/скопируйте содержащийся в нем файл «.exe».
пссст: Какой дистрибутив Linux самый безопасный?

9 лихорадка. 2017 г.

Как открыть Firefox в селене?

Запуск браузера Firefox

  1. Загрузите geckodriver.exe со страницы выпуска GeckoDriver Github. …
  2. Установите для системного свойства значение «webdriver.gecko.driver» с путем geckodriver.exe — System.setProperty («webdriver.gecko.driver», «path geckodriver.exe»);

Как установить путь к Geckodriver на Mac?

Конфигурация системного пути

  1. Загрузите исполняемый файл GeckoDriver.
  2. Откройте Терминал.
  3. Запустите sudo nano /etc/path.
  4. Введите ваш пароль.
  5. Введите путь к загрузке geckodriver в нижней части файла.
  6. Мой ПУТЬ: /Users/winston/Downloads/geckodriver.
  7. Control + x для выхода.
  8. и сохранить.

26 апр. 2019 г.

Какой тип приложения представляет собой Selenium IDE?

Selenium IDE (интегрированная среда разработки) — это прежде всего инструмент записи/выполнения, используемый разработчиком тестовых случаев для разработки тестовых случаев Selenium.

Как Firefox определяет драйвер селена?

setproperty(«webdriver.gecko.driver», Path_of_Firefox_Driver «); метод установки пути к драйверу Firefox (GeckoDriver). Затем вы создали объект драйвера Firefox для создания экземпляра браузера Mozilla Firefox и запуска тестовых случаев.

Может ли селен взаимодействовать со скрытыми элементами?

Selenium был специально написан, чтобы НЕ разрешать взаимодействие со скрытыми элементами. … Однако Selenium позволяет вам запускать Javascript в контексте элемента, поэтому вы можете написать Javascript для выполнения события щелчка, даже если оно скрыто.

Related Articles

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Back to top button